Q: How to replace the radiator for the 8.1L engine on GMC Sierra 3500?
A: The first step to replace the 8.1l engine Radiator involves taking away the Radiator inlet hose and Radiator outlet hose. Start by taking off the lower Fan Shroud together with the air cleaner assembly followed by uninstalling the air cleaner adapter push pin and bolts to free it from the vehicle. The surge tank inlet hose requires removal alongside the repositioning of its clamp at the Radiator location. It is essential to disconnect the Radiator lines for engine oil and transmission cooling before removing the bolts for the removal of the Radiator. To install the new Radiator position it then fasten the Radiator bolts while tightening them to 25 nm (18 ft. Lbs.). Reposition the surge tank inlet hose clamp at the Radiator before you build the transmission oil cooler line connection to the Radiator in addition to the engine oil cooler line connection. Reinstall the air cleaner adapter on the vehicle by using bolts with 9 nm torque (80 inch lbs.) before putting on the push pin and air cleaner assembly and lower Fan Shroud. Installing the two hoses known as the Radiator outlet and Radiator inlet requires completion for vehicles with 8.1l engines.
